Deck 12: Literary Terms and Techniques for Fiction Writing
1
Biography written with the permission, cooperation, and, at times, participation of a subject or a subject's heirs is called

A)Secular autobiography
B)Spiritual autobiography
C)Legacy writing
D)Authorized biography
Authorized biography
2
'Parallel Lives' was written by

A)Plutarch
B)Goethe
C)Montaigne
D)Dryden
Plutarch
3
……………is the source of Shakespeare's Roman plays

A)Parallel Lives
B)The Invisible Man
C)The Prelude
D)On the Road
Parallel Lives
